Google DeepMind: Profile, Timeline & Daily-Updated Analysis

Google DeepMind is Alphabet's unified AI research and product lab, formed from the 2023 merger of the original DeepMind startup and Google Brain, led by CEO Demis Hassabis. It develops the Gemini family of models alongside scientific AI systems like AlphaFold, and drives much of Google's frontier AI and AGI research. Timeline

This timeline grows automatically as news breaks. 10 events on record.

2026-06-22Alphabet shares fell roughly 5-7% in a single day after top researchers Noam Shazeer and John Jumper departed for OpenAI and Anthropic, wiping an estimated $225 billion in market value.
2025-11-18Google launched Gemini 3, introducing a 'Deep Think' reasoning mode and topping key AI benchmarks, prompting rivals to react.
2024-10-09Demis Hassabis and John Jumper won the Nobel Prize in Chemistry for AlphaFold's protein-structure prediction work.
2023-04-01Google merged DeepMind with Google Brain into a single unit, Google DeepMind, under Demis Hassabis to accelerate frontier model development.
2021-01-01DeepMind spun off Isomorphic Labs to apply AI to drug discovery.
2020-11-30AlphaFold2 achieved a breakthrough in predicting protein structures, later expanding to nearly all known proteins.
2019-01-24DeepMind introduced AlphaStar, which achieved grandmaster-level play in StarCraft II.
2016-03-01DeepMind's AlphaGo defeated Go world champion Lee Sedol in a five-game match, a landmark AI milestone.
2014-01-01Google acquired DeepMind for roughly $500-650 million, keeping the team in London under an ethics oversight agreement.
2010-09-01DeepMind Technologies founded in London by Demis Hassabis, Shane Legg, and Mustafa Suleyman to pursue artificial general intelligence.

Frequently Asked Questions

Who founded Google DeepMind and when?

DeepMind was founded in London in 2010 by Demis Hassabis, Shane Legg, and Mustafa Suleyman with the goal of 'solving intelligence.' Google acquired it in 2014, and it became 'Google DeepMind' after merging with Google Brain in April 2023.

How is Google DeepMind related to Google and Alphabet?

Google DeepMind is a wholly owned subsidiary of Alphabet Inc., serving as Alphabet's core AI research and model-development arm. It is headquartered in London with research centers across the US, Canada, France, Germany, and Switzerland.

What are Google DeepMind's biggest achievements?

Its most famous milestones include AlphaGo's 2016 defeat of Go champion Lee Sedol, AlphaFold's near-complete mapping of known protein structures (which won Demis Hassabis and John Jumper a Nobel Prize), and the ongoing development of the Gemini large language model family.

Is Google DeepMind the same as Google Brain?

No, they were originally separate AI teams. Google Brain was Google's internal AI research group, while DeepMind was an independently acquired London lab; the two were merged into a single 'Google DeepMind' organization in April 2023 to unify Alphabet's AI efforts.

When does Google DeepMind think AGI will arrive?

CEO Demis Hassabis has said he expects artificial general intelligence around 2030, plus or minus a year, though he has more recently suggested 2029 is possible given rapid progress in agentic AI.
